BMW Sauber Silverstone test notes 2006-04-27

Robert Kubica had a busy day as he was the only BMW Sauber F1 Team driver at the test today so he drove both chassis. He worked on aero and damper comparisons with chassis 06 and also completed some long tyre compound runs for Michelin. With chassis 07 he completed aero work.

What comes next: This was the end of the three day test for the BMW Sauber F1 Team. Over the three days the teams’ drivers, Jacques Villeneuve, Nick Heidfeld and Robert Kubia, covered a total of 1,700 kilometres between them.

Next week the team has its first home race, the European Grand Prix at the Nürburgring, and the official opening of the team’s Pit Lane Park.

Robert Kubica
Chassis: BMW Sauber F1.06-06
Engine: BMW P86 V8
Test kilometres today: 195 km (38 laps)
Fastest lap: 1:20.930

Chassis: BMW Sauber F1.06-07
Engine: BMW P86 V8
Test kilometres today: 149 km (29 laps)
Fastest lap: 1:21.371
